Fault and event tree analyses are widely used techniques for performing probabilistic safety assessments (PSAs). These methods have traditionally been used as part of a safety case. However, fault and event tree analysis techniques may also be used in an operational environment monitoring the effect of failures and scheduled maintenance tasks.

Using RiskVu as a Real-Time Risk Monitor

RiskVu allows operators to precisely assess the current safety status of safety systems in a few seconds. Future scheduled maintenance scenarios may also be computed within seconds and results viewed in schematic, graphical or tabular format.

The RiskVu risk monitor need not require the end-user to know anything about fault trees or probability theory. Experienced reliability engineers can develop the basic fault tree models off-line using FaultTree+.
